While at The Strawberry Festival this weekend, I had to stop this guy and ask him about his enormous shark tooth. He was kind enough to tell me a little about it and how he regularly finds fossilized shark teeth in Peace River. He said he has one twice that size at home. This guy was so awesome. He was the most interesting and colorful person I saw the entire day.

This is kind of an unusual post for me. I’m not one to post fuzzy pictures but in this case I think it adds to the impact of the message. This past Saturday we went to the Strawberry Festival to see the Christian rock band “Mercy Me.” We were sitting in the FREE seats way up high in the back of the stadium. During one particularly moving moment in the show I looked around to see so many people being moved by the Spirit of God. What I like about this image is that the people seem to resemble spirits as well.
